CHANGES IN OUR LIVES
Our future is a mystery,
So oft arriving with surprise;
We think some things can never be,
But oft our fate will open eyes.
As bitter foes become fast friends,
When understanding has been reached;
Undying friendship sometime ends,
When basic ethics have been breached.
Impossible should not be heard,
All barriers will sometime fall;
And many things once thought absurd,
Become routine, one climbed the wall.
Sol the Sage
